> What is the difference between
> org.apache.commons.collections.map.ListOrderedMap (from
> commons-collections-3.2) and
> java.util.LinkedHashMap (Java 1.5)?
>
> It seems to me that they both implement a map while retaining
> order.  Am I
> missing something?

Yep. The implementation from c-c works also for JDKs pre 1.4 ...
